WARRENSBURG, Mo. (Feb. 16, 2017)-- Lincoln rallied back from a 10-point deficit with just over three minutes to play to force overtime and defeat Central Missouri 70-63 on Thursday night at the Multi. With the loss, the Mules have their three-game winning streak end as they drop to 17-7 overall and 11-5 in MIAA play.
The Mules led 51-41 with 3:06 to play in regulation after
Marquiez Lawrence hit a layup, but the Blue Tigers (15-11, 8-9 MIAA) outscored the Mules 16-6 in regulation and 13-6 in OT to get the win.
O'Shai Clark hit a layup to pull Lincoln within eight with 2:46 to play, but a technical foul was called on the Blue Tigers bench immediately after.
Spencer Reaves went 1-for-2 at the line to give the Mules a nine-point edge, 52-43, with 2:03 left to play. Anthony Virdue was fouled on the ensuing Lincoln possession, made both free throws, then Richie Lewis scored a layup to cut the UCM's lead to seven, 52-45.
The Mules struggled to score down the stretch, with their final five points coming at the charity strip. Reaves hit two free throws with 1:20 to play, giving UCM a 54-47 advantage, but the Blue Tigers answered back with Maurice Mason hitting a three-pointer with 1:10 on the clock, followed by a jumper from Jaylon Smith.
Jakob Lowrance added a pair free throws to give UCM a 56-53 tilt with 32 seconds on the clock, while
Kyle Wolf made one of two free throws.
In overtime, Lincoln came out hitting a three with 4:08 on the clock to take their first lead of the game since the 16:02 mark in the first half when they led 6-5. The Mules scored a pair of free throws to cut Lincoln's lead to 60-59. The Blue Tigers then went on a 5-0 run to push their lead to 64-59. Dashuan Rice scored the Mules final four points, both on layups, but it was not enough as Lincoln hit 6-of-8 free throws down the stretch to secure the win.
The Mules 10-point lead in the second half was their largest of the game. The Mules scored their first field goal of the second half with 17:22 to play off a Richardson layup, giving UCM a 31-25 lead. Lincoln scored a layup 23 second later as Virdure penetrated the lane. The Blue Tigers cut their deficit to two, 31-29, with Kevin Bohlen adding a layup, but Reaves answered with a three giving UCM the 34-29 advantage. They traded shots until the 7:14 mark when UCM had a 43-41 lead and went on an 8-0 run to go up 10.
The game was tight the whole first half, with the Mules leading much of the half. Lincoln lead 6-5 with 16:02 to play, but the Mules retook the lead with Reaves hitting a three pointer to make it an 8-6 lead for UCM. The Mules stretched their lead to as much as eight in the first half.
Spencer Reaves led the Mules in scoring with 23 points and tied a career-high in rebounds with seven, also to lead UCM. He finished the game 7-of-13 from the field, and 4-of-6 from the three-point line.
Kyle Wolf added 12 points on 4-of-10 shooting. The Mules shot 40 percent from the field going 22-of-55. They were 13-of-21 for 62 percent from the free throw line, and went 6-of-22 from behind the arc to finish at 27 percent.
Smith led Lincoln with a game-high 27 points and nine rebounds, while Virdue added 20 and Mason chipped in 10. Lincoln was 21-of-54 from the field for 39 percent and was 24-of-29 at the free throw line for 83 percent.
